<p>1,156,080. Reactive azo dyes. SUMITOMO CHEMICAL CO. Ltd. 27 Nov., 1967 [13 April, 1967], No. 53812/67. Heading C4P. The invention comprises reactive dyes of the general formula wherein R is methyl or ethyl: one X is hydrogen and the other a sulphonic acid group; and Y is acetyl, chloracetyl, or a benzoyl or benzenesulphonyl group which may be substituted by halogen and or alkyl groups. They are prepared by coupling a diazotized 3-#-hydroxyethylsulphonyl-4-methoxy- or 4-ethoxy-aniline or sulphuric acid ester thereof with an appropriate aminonaphtholsulphonic acid, followed by esterification with sulphuric acid when the 3-#-hydroxy ethylsulphuryl compound is used. The reactive dyes obtained dye hydroxyl group containing, e.g. cotton, and nitrogen containing, e.g. wool, textile materials in bluish red shades.</p> |
